Ethylenediaminetetraacetic acid-d16

Catalog No.: B11847
Stable Isotope
Ethylenediaminetetraacetic acid-d16 is a deuterated form of Ethylenediaminetetraacetic acid (EDTA), a well-known metal chelator that targets divalent and trivalent metal cations, including calcium. It exhibits anticoagulant properties and helps combat hypercalcemia. EDTA-d16 is effective in reducing metal ion-induced oxidative damage to proteins, facilitating a reducing environment during protein purification, and minimizing disulfide bond formation. This reagent is essential for various biochemical and analytical applications, particularly in studies involving metal ion interactions and protein stability.

Product Information
Catalog NumB11847
FormulaC10D16N2O8
Molecular Weight308.34
CAS Number203805-96-3
SMILES[2H]OC(C([2H])([2H])N(C([2H])([2H])C(O[2H])=O)C([2H])([2H])C([2H])([2H])N(C([2H])([2H])C(O[2H])=O)C([2H])([2H])C(O[2H])=O)=O
SynonymsEDTA-d16
